PERSONAL.

Air J. 11. L. Stanford returned to Stratford on Saturday after a visit to Australia. Inspectors Ballantyne and Whetter, of the Taranaki Education Board, are to-day inspecting the Stratford School. The death occurred suddenly, through heart failure of Mr McCauley Stuart, president of the Victorian Commercial Travellers’ Association. Dr. Johnston, of Wellington, wellknown in the Stratford district, where he has previously worked, is acting as locum tenons for Dr. Steven, medical superintendent ol the Stratford Hospital, during the latter’s absence on annual leave.
